Chopadaru in context

With 444 people at the 2011 Census, Chopadaru was the 262nd most populous of its district's 315 villages, below the district average of 1,684.

Literacy stood at 73.02%, 6.2 points above the district's rural average of 66.83%.

The sex ratio was 1037 women per 1,000 men (88 above the district's rural figure of 949) — one of the minority of villages where women outnumbered men. Among children aged 0–6 the ratio was 1000, 77 above the rural national 923.

26.8% of the population were recorded as workers, 10.2 points below the district's rural rate.
